Summary:
Based on Charles Dickens's classic novel, Nicholas Nickleby tells the story of the eponymous young hero and his attempts to save his family and friends from the clutches of his greedy Uncle Ralph. Staying true to the dark mood of the book, director Alberto Cavalcanti conjures up a triumphantly atmospheric adaptation featuring indelible performances from Hardwicke and Bond
